Xpenditure vs Jellyfish

Struggling to choose between Xpenditure and Jellyfish? Both products offer unique advantages, making it a tough decision.

Xpenditure is a Office & Productivity solution with tags like personal-finance, expense-tracking, budgeting.

It boasts features such as Transaction management, Budgeting tools, Visual graphs, Reporting, Bank account integration and pros including Free and open source, User-friendly interface, Customizable categories and budgets, Automatic sync with bank accounts, Good for tracking day-to-day expenses.

On the other hand, Jellyfish is a Science & Education product tagged with dna-sequencing, kmer-counting, coverage-depth, genome-assembly, transcriptome-assembly.

Its standout features include Fast k-mer counting, Low memory usage, Multi-threaded, Dumps k-mer counts to disk, Can load k-mer counts from disk, Supports multiple hash array sizes, and it shines with pros like Very fast even for large datasets, Scales well with large amounts of threads/CPU cores, Low RAM usage allows analysis of big data on normal machines.

To help you make an informed decision, we've compiled a comprehensive comparison of these two products, delving into their features, pros, cons, pricing, and more. Get ready to explore the nuances that set them apart and determine which one is the perfect fit for your requirements.

Xpenditure

Xpenditure

Xpenditure is an open-source personal finance manager and expense tracker. It allows users to track income, expenses, budgets, and bank accounts. Key features include transaction management, reporting, budgeting tools, and visual graphs.

Categories:
personal-finance expense-tracking budgeting

Xpenditure Features

  1. Transaction management
  2. Budgeting tools
  3. Visual graphs
  4. Reporting
  5. Bank account integration

Pricing

  • Open Source

Pros

Free and open source

User-friendly interface

Customizable categories and budgets

Automatic sync with bank accounts

Good for tracking day-to-day expenses

Cons

Limited reporting features compared to paid options

No mobile app

Can be slow with large datasets


Jellyfish

Jellyfish

Jellyfish is an open-source program for analyzing DNA sequencing reads. It can calculate statistics like k-mer counts and coverage depth for large datasets quickly and with low memory usage. Jellyfish is useful for preparing reads for genome or transcriptome assembly.

Categories:
dna-sequencing kmer-counting coverage-depth genome-assembly transcriptome-assembly

Jellyfish Features

  1. Fast k-mer counting
  2. Low memory usage
  3. Multi-threaded
  4. Dumps k-mer counts to disk
  5. Can load k-mer counts from disk
  6. Supports multiple hash array sizes

Pricing

  • Open Source

Pros

Very fast even for large datasets

Scales well with large amounts of threads/CPU cores

Low RAM usage allows analysis of big data on normal machines

Cons

Command line only, no GUI

Not as full-featured as some commercial competitors

Can be complex to set up and use for beginners